Castlegar, BC Real Estate - Houses For Sale in Castlegar, British Columbia
Homes for sale in Castlegar mainly comprise properties that took shape during the 1960s and 1970s, with a notable portion dating back to pre-1960 and seeing a resurgence in the 1990s. The city hosts mostly single detached homes, although there's a fair share of duplexes and townhouses adding to the mix. Approximately 75% of homeowners reside in their properties, leaving the remainder available for rent. The neighborhood predominantly features homes with three bedrooms or more, with the average listing price on MLS® pegged at $684,125. Read more about Castlegar real estate

About Living in Castlegar, British Columbia
Transportation
Cars are an excellent means of transportation in this city. It is a rather short drive to the closest highway from any home in Castlegar, and it is very convenient to find a parking spot. Most houses for sale in this city are located in places that are not very conducive to walking because running common errands is challenging.
Services
High schools and primary schools are not especially plentiful in this city, and thus tend to be a rather long walk away. Furthermore, families may consider it challenging for their schoolchildren to access daycares on foot. Regarding eating, some, but not all, home buyers in this city will reside within walking distance of the nearest grocery store. A limited number of restaurants are available in this city as well.
Character
Castlegar is quiet overall, as the streets are reasonably peaceful - although that is not the case near the railway line or the airport (YCG).
